Bug 1364975 - Allow WebExtensions to disable WebRTC, r=aswan
Implement privacy.network.peerConnectionEnabled to allow WebExtensions to enable and disable RTCPeerConnections (aka WebRTC). MozReview-Commit-ID: 5zGotQNwsko --HG-- extra : rebase_source : 3543efa9fdbd7689581b3ffd3507cf2b4fee284d
